Transaction dda2c86bae43053acee81fa2861dbbabdd6631ea1defc4b182f1f5515cee7e3f
1 Input
1 Output
-
dda2c86bae43053acee81fa2861dbbabdd6631ea1defc4b182f1f5515cee7e3f: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d9807967b4009293d6b23043156cd93a0c9772497010b2e12b79e776e6dfb672
- address
- bc1pmxq8jea5qzff844jxpp32mxe8gxfwujfwqgt9cft08nhdeklkeeqpfp7wr